The current age of Edwin is 99. Records link phone number (651) 459-2669 with Edwin’s details. Edwin currently resides at 180 Magnolia Woods Ct #11B, Deltona, Fl 32725. Edwin's birth year is 1925. People possibly related to Edwin are Michael C Walseth, Lois D Walseth, Lois D Walsreth and 2 other people. Other cities that he has stayed in are Deltona and Saint Paul Park.